Breaking News... First statement from Devlet Bahçeli regarding the Can Atalay meeting in the Turkish Parliament: A notable 'early election' message
MHP leader Devlet Bahçeli, in a statement following the tumultuous Can Atalay session in the Turkish Parliament, said, "The Can Atalay issue is completely closed."
The Grand National Assembly of Turkey (TBMM) convened yesterday (August 16) at 2:00 PM for Can Atalay, a Hatay deputy from the Workers' Party of Turkey (TİP), regarding whom the Constitutional Court (AYM) had issued a ruling that the revocation of his parliamentary seat was "null and void."
AKP's Alpay Özalan attacked TİP Istanbul deputy Ahmet Şık. The session was adjourned 5 times due to the incidents that occurred in Parliament.
REJECTED BY MAJORITY VOTE
In the final session held after the tumultuous proceedings, the opposition's request for a general debate regarding Can Atalay was rejected by a majority vote.
BAHÇELİ'S STATEMENT ON CAN ATALAY
MHP Chairman Devlet Bahçeli, who did not attend the Can Atalay session in the TBMM, broke his silence following the events in Parliament.
In a statement on his social media account, Bahçeli included the phrase, "The Can Atalay issue is completely closed."
Bahçeli's post is as follows:
"The founding process of both the Grand National Assembly of Turkey and the Republic of Turkey, while witnessing arduous struggles, has also been a source of inspiration for societies or nations longing for independence. The heroism displayed and the sacrifices made during the National Struggle have undoubtedly provided spirit and hope to geographies suffering under the grip of captivity and exploitation.
The Turkish nation has resisted oppression in every period of history and has raised its voice and words against tyrants. Naturally, as the manifestation of the national will, the Grand National Assembly of Turkey has determinedly, and even with a consciousness of historical responsibility, undertaken the role of being the voice of our kinsmen and religious brothers who have been subjected to injustice and attack.
The magnificent address delivered by the President of the State of Palestine, Mr. Mahmoud Abbas, in the Veteran Parliament on August 15, 2024, must be evaluated within this context. On that day, the eyes of the world were turned to the Grand National Assembly of Turkey. The fact that a will and power that saved a homeland and founded a state embraced the Palestinian cause, and that Mr. Abbas's historic speech consequently had regional and global repercussions, is truly an important and exceptional development.
"THE TRAGIC AND UNFORTUNATE EVENTS THAT OCCURRED IN THE VETERAN PARLIAMENT ARE EXTREMELY SAD"
However, the tragic and unfortunate events that occurred one day later in the Veteran Parliament, which had become the center of political and diplomatic gravity for the world on August 15, 2024, and had drawn all attention to itself, unfortunately overshadowed the previous day.
This picture is extremely sad. The political provocation mechanism that wanted to take TİP's Can Atalay out of prison and bring him to Parliament, despite there being a finalized conviction against him, stirred up trouble with all its incitement and plotting.
The hateful, sharp words of a deputy from TİP, who is against the state and the nation and who distorted parliamentary immunity in a purposeful and morbid manner, raised tensions to the point of bloodshed. However, grace was born out of hardship, and dawn broke in the overshadowed Veteran Parliament.
"THE CONSTITUTIONAL COURT'S SLOPPY RULING ON RIGHTS VIOLATIONS HAS BEEN THROWN IN THE TRASH, AND LAWLESSNESS HAS NOT BEEN PERMITTED"
Indeed, the Can Atalay issue is completely closed. The mask of the 'DEM-ified' CHP has fallen once again. The Constitutional Court's sloppy ruling on rights violations, which established a process contrary to the Constitution and disregarded its own precedents, has been thrown in the trash by the will of the Turkish nation, and lawlessness has not been permitted.
"I WISH FOR IT TO BE KNOWN THAT THERE IS NO ELECTION ON TURKEY'S AGENDA"
The Nationalist Movement Party did not attend the parliamentary session where the Can Atalay issue, which was watered down from top to bottom and torn from its original context, was discussed. This was because it was desired that the clear exposure of what kind of scheme the 'DEM-ified' CHP, the marginalized TİP, the PKK apparatuses, and the Constitutional Court, which periodically takes decisions against Turkey and the Turkish nation, were the perpetrators of, be seen.
Furthermore, an important result that has manifested is this:
The AK Party, one of the founders of the People's Alliance, did what was necessary even without the Nationalist Movement Party, and with a commendable stance, did not allow injustice, lawlessness, and banditry. Those who asked 'where is the junior partner' got their answer, and a decision in line with our nation's expectations was taken even without us.
In addition to this, yesterday's vote once again pointed to and confirmed the AK Party as Turkey's leading party. Those who polished the 'DEM-ified' CHP after the March 31, 2024 Local Administration Elections, and those who constantly told the fairy tale of 'the leading party, far ahead in the polls,' have personally witnessed that black propaganda was wiped away with the Can Atalay decision.
I have full faith that the AK Party will continue its struggle with confident, strong, and self-assured steps, and will implement the necessary chain of reforms under the roof of the People's Alliance until the 2028 elections. I especially wish for it to be known that,
There is no election on Turkey's agenda. Everyone must make their political and ideological calculations in accordance with this unchangeable fact. To those who use expressions full of reproach against us by calling us the 'junior partner,' I say this: wherever the nation wants to see us, that is where we are. As the People's Alliance, we continue on our path with determination and faith."
